Call for Papers

The Eclipse Foundation, together with the M2M and Polarsys Industry Working Groups, are pleased to invite you to a day of exchanges around two topics strongly anchored in Toulouse and its area: Machine-to-Machine and Embedded Systems Engineering. This one-day event will feature keynotes and presentations highlighting cutting-edge topics in these fields, related to, but not limited to:

  • News and Noteworthy of Eclipse projects
    • Eclipse projects are expected to submit a presentation for a demo of their new developments
  • Technical innovations
    • Embedded OSGi
    • M2M & Embedded Development Tools
    • Open Source Hardware
    • Scalable infrastructures
    • Device Management
    • Cloud infrastructure
    • Data management
    • Model Based Engineering
    • Simulation
    • Embedded Debugging
    • ALM (Version Control Systems, technical facts management, etc.)
    • Requirements Engineering
    • Validation & Verification (code analysis, testing, formal proof)
    • Qualification of tools
  • Business innovations
    • Industry-oriented communities
    • Very Long Term Support
    • Business Models
    • SaaS

Presentations

Presentations will be 30 minutes long, including time for questions. There will be a projector to support your presentation, but you will need to provide your own laptop. Post your abstract or presentation here.

Language: English/French

Important Dates

Submission deadline April 15th, 2012
All Notification of acceptance April 24th, 2012
Final version due May 10th, 2012
Workshop date May 24th, 2012

Sponsoring

We would like to invite companies to participate as sponsors of the Eclipse Day Toulouse. Here you have an opportunity demonstrate your affiliation to Eclipse technology and services related to the themes of the event (Polarsys, Internet-of-Things/M2M).

You will receive the following benefits:

  • Company displayed on the event web site.
  • Ability to distribute product information at the event.
  • Company information area at the event.

Cost Sponsorships will be used to support event materials and catering for lunch and breaks. Sponsors are asked to contribute EUR 1,500 + VAT per company. The sponsor fee will solely be used for event marketing and execution (catering, facilities).
